Officials break ground for county's largest retail center
Mandy Sheets
Of the Suburban Journals
Wentzville Journal

snip

The 800,000-square-foot retail center will be anchored by the first Wal-Mart Supercenter in St. Charles County and "the most expensive store the company has ever built," said developer Don LaBrayere at the groundbreaking ceremony. The Wal-Mart store is aiming to open its doors Oct. 1, and will be the first store to open in the development. That opening date will coincide with the completion of a neighboring road construction project.

snip

Mayor Mike Potter also thanked everyone involved in the project and announced the road that the project is located on will be renamed Ronald Reagan Drive.
